彻底解决OBS-NDI插件找不到NDI运行环境的完整修复教程
【免费下载链接】obs-ndiNewTek NDI integration for OBS Studio项目地址: https://gitcode.com/gh_mirrors/ob/obs-ndi
当你满怀期待地安装好OBS-NDI插件,准备体验高效的多机位视频流传输时,突然弹出的"NDI Runtime Not Found"错误提示确实令人沮丧。别担心,这个问题的根源很明确,解决方案也很系统化。本文将带你一步步排查并彻底修复这个技术障碍。
问题现象与初步诊断
首先我们需要准确识别问题的具体表现。NDI Runtime缺失通常表现为以下几种情况:
- OBS启动时直接弹出红色错误对话框
- 在添加NDI源或NDI输出时功能选项灰色不可用
- 系统提示缺少必要的NDI基础组件
问题根源深度剖析
NDI Runtime本质上是一套底层的视频流处理库,它为所有基于NDI技术的应用程序提供统一的接口支持。可以把它想象成视频领域的"运行环境",就像Java程序需要JVM,.NET程序需要Framework一样。
具体来说,NDI Runtime包含以下几个关键组件:
- 网络发现服务:用于在局域网内自动发现NDI设备
- 视频编解码器:处理视频流的压缩和解压缩
- 音频处理模块:管理音频流的同步和传输
- 设备管理接口:协调多个NDI设备的协作
实战操作:分步修复指南
第一步:环境准备工作
在开始修复前,请确保你的系统环境满足以下基本条件:
- 操作系统版本:Windows 10或Windows 11的64位系统
- 管理员权限:拥有安装软件的系统权限
- OBS版本:31.0.1或更新的稳定版本
第二步:获取正确的NDI Runtime安装包
访问NewTek官方网站,找到NDI Runtime的下载页面。这里有几点需要注意:
- 选择与你的系统架构匹配的版本(通常是x64)
- 下载最新稳定版本,避免使用测试版
- 确认下载文件的完整性,避免损坏的安装包
第三步:执行安装程序
这是最关键的操作步骤,请严格按照以下流程执行:
- 完全退出OBS:确保OBS Studio已经完全关闭,包括系统托盘中的图标
- 管理员权限运行:右键点击安装程序,选择"以管理员身份运行"
- 安装选项配置:
- 接受许可协议
- 选择默认安装路径
- 使用典型安装模式
- 等待安装完成:过程中不要中断,直到看到安装成功的提示
第四步:系统重启与组件验证
安装完成后,强烈建议重启计算机。重启后可以通过以下方式验证安装是否成功:
- 检查Windows"程序和功能"列表中是否有"NDI Runtime"条目
- 确认系统目录中存在NDI相关动态链接库文件
- 重新启动OBS检查错误提示是否消失
常见疑难问题排解
在实际操作过程中,你可能会遇到一些特殊情况,这里提供针对性的解决方案:
安装失败怎么办?
- 检查系统剩余磁盘空间是否充足
- 关闭杀毒软件的实时保护功能
- 清理系统临时文件后重试
版本兼容性问题
- 如果安装了多个版本的NDI Runtime,建议全部卸载后重新安装最新版本
- 确保OBS-NDI插件版本与NDI Runtime版本匹配
权限相关问题
- 在Windows 11中,用户账户控制设置可能过于严格
- 尝试临时禁用UAC或使用内置管理员账户进行安装
修复效果检验标准
成功修复后,你应该能够看到以下积极变化:
- 错误提示消失:OBS启动时不再弹出NDI Runtime缺失的警告
- 功能选项可用:在"来源"中添加"NDI源"和在"工具"中使用"NDI输出"都应该正常工作
- 视频流传输稳定:能够正常发现局域网内的NDI设备并建立稳定的视频连接
预防措施与最佳实践
为了避免类似问题再次发生,建议建立以下维护习惯:
- 在安装任何NDI相关软件前,先检查NDI Runtime状态
- 定期更新NDI Runtime到最新版本
- 在系统重大更新后,重新验证NDI组件的完整性
通过这套系统化的修复方案,你不仅能够快速解决当前的NDI Runtime缺失问题,还能建立一套完整的NDI技术维护体系,为未来的视频制作工作提供坚实的技术保障。
【免费下载链接】obs-ndiNewTek NDI integration for OBS Studio项目地址: https://gitcode.com/gh_mirrors/ob/obs-ndi
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考